Yosef Karo Shulchan Aruch — 50 General laws about punctured body parts

And all that we said that if it's removed it's treif, it's the same rule if it's created missing it, but there are some who rule this kosher.
(o.o.) (And if it's a big loss it's you can rely on those who rule it kosher) . 3 Any body part that invalidates it if it's punctured or missing or removed, if it's decomposed it invalidates it too.
Rema: But for us who are not expert - whenever the flesh is altered to a fault, it should be considered as a puncture there (H"M and Mord') .
